This Schedule 14D-9 filing consists of the following communications related to the proposed acquisition of Castlight Health, Inc., a Delaware corporation (“Castlight” or the “Company”), by Vera Whole Health, Inc., a Delaware corporation (“Vera” or “Parent”), and Carbon Merger Sub, Inc., a Delaware corporation and wholly-owned subsidiary of Parent (“Merger Sub”), pursuant to the terms of the Agreement and Plan of Merger dated January 4, 2022, by and among the Company, Parent and Merger Sub (the “Merger Agreement”):

 

   

Exhibit 99.1: Employee FAQs, sent on January 5, 2022

 

   

Exhibit 99.2: Email to Employees, sent on January 5, 2022

 

   

Exhibit 99.3: Social Media Content
